About this service

Corrugated metal roofing features a series of parallel ridges and grooves that add strength to thin metal sheets. It is a popular, cost-effective choice for barns, sheds, and some residential roofs due to its lightweight design. You should look into this if you need a budget-friendly way to shed water quickly. What kind of fasteners are used for metal roofing in Boston?

For metal roofing installations in Boston, licensed pros typically use specialized roofing nails and screws. These fasteners are designed to penetrate the metal panels and the roof deck securely. They are often coated to resist corrosion, which is vital given Boston's humid climate and potential for salt spray near the coast. Proper fastening is critical for the longevity and performance of your metal roof.

What's involved in a typical metal roof installation in Boston?

A metal roof installation in Boston involves several key steps. First, pros prepare the existing roof deck, ensuring it's clean and structurally sound. Then, they lay down an underlayment for added protection. Metal panels are carefully measured, cut, and fastened to the roof structure using specialized screws. Flashing is installed around vents, chimneys, and edges to prevent leaks. Finally, the roof is inspected to ensure everything is secure and properly sealed.
